Edward B.
Brandon is currently the Director at John Carroll University, CardinalCommerce Corp., and a Trustee at Notre Dame College (Ohio).
He previously served as the Chief Executive Officer at National City Bank (Cleveland, Ohio), Chairman at National City Corp., and Director at RPM International, Inc. He also held director positions at The Musical Arts Association, Saint Vincent Charity Hospital, United Way Services of Northern Columbiana County, and Cleveland Tomorrow.
Additionally, he was a member of The Financial Services Roundtable and is now a Trustee-Emeritus at The Cleveland Clinic Foundation.
Mr. Brandon holds an MBA from the University of Pennsylvania and an undergraduate degree from Northwestern University.
